MANUFACTURE OF ICING SUGAR

RESTRICTION'S RELAXED. By Telegraph-Press Association. Auckland, December V. The restrictions on M»e inanulactuw and sale of icing sugar, imposed.in July last, have been relaxed by tho Boaiid of Trade until January 15 next. Hitherto this commodity could only be manutactured from ordinary sugar by special permit from the board. Now awone Wishing for icing sugur. may toko then allotment to tho grinders and lin>o, it ground. The lifting oi tho embargo will not affect tho Hinount of sugar alloled at present, nor call for any inoreased output. It simply permits of turnin;,' ordinary sugar into icing sugar a« the possessor's wish.
